Global Secondary Antibodies Market Forecast: Growth to USD 2.97 Billion by 2033



In recent years, the market for secondary antibodies has shown remarkable resilience, reflecting a surge in demand primarily driven by evolving laboratory practices. Verified Market Research has revealed that the global secondary antibodies market is projected to reach a substantial USD 2.97 billion by 2033, essentially doubling its value from USD 1.62 billion in 2025, with a compound annual growth rate (CAGR) of 7.9% throughout this forecast period. This impressive escalation can largely be attributed to the increasing reliance on standardized immunoassay workflows and the intensifying focus on biomarker research.

Drivers of Growth


The burgeoning secondary antibodies market is being shaped by several key factors, which highlight the ongoing transformation within laboratories. A significant driver of this market is the standardization of immunoassay workflows. As laboratories implement standard protocols to enhance the reproducibility of results, the choice of secondary antibodies has gained pivotal importance. The effectiveness of these antibodies directly impacts signal strength, background noise, and overall assay comparability, thus representing an essential component of lab quality assurance.

Moreover, the intensification of protein biomarker research has created a substantial uptick in the demand for secondary antibodies. In projects where protein characterization and biomarker validation are crucial, the ability of secondary antibodies to offer signal amplification and consistency becomes indispensable. The increased throughput required in contemporary research settings has enriched consumption, prompting laboratories to adopt a more recurring purchasing model, as opposed to one-time reagent orders.

The Role of Quality and Traceability


Another critical aspect influencing the growth trajectory of the secondary antibodies market is the stringent quality requirements surrounding batch consistency and lot traceability. As the emphasis on experimental reproducibility heightens, laboratories are gravitating towards suppliers who can assure consistent performance across production lots. These stringent quality expectations translate into a marked preference for secondary antibodies that offer predictable outcomes, thus making procurement choices more compliance-driven.

Market Segmentation and Key Players


The market can be segmented into categories based on the type of secondary antibodies, their applications, and end-users. Major segments include Goat and Rabbit Secondary Antibodies, predominantly utilized in immunoassays like Western blotting and immunoprecipitation. End-users primarily consist of academic research institutes and pharmaceutical biotechnology companies, each driven by distinct procurement behaviors and validation requirements.

Prominent names in the secondary antibodies market include Thermo Fisher Scientific, Jackson ImmunoResearch Laboratories, BD Biosciences, Santa Cruz Biotechnology, and Bio-Rad, all of whom leverage their respective strengths in product differentiation to maintain competitive edges. Notably, Thermo Fisher Scientific capitalizes on its extensive portfolio and integration capabilities, while Jackson ImmunoResearch is recognized for its market specialization.

Regional Dynamics


Regionally, North America dominates the secondary antibodies market, holding approximately 38% market share, thanks to its robust biotechnology infrastructure and a strong concentration of academic and R&D institutions. Meanwhile, the Asia Pacific region is emerging as a dynamic player with rapidly accelerating life sciences capabilities, poised for significant growth in the coming years.
